Give Me a Complete Software.
The other day I bought a software loaded machine, my HP powered
Notebook and I found that the hardware sold to me by the Company was not
compatible with the Software. It was slow in working, opening and closing the files
saving in the folders of my choice after some changes that I make. I could not
open a good number of webpages just to examine the facts for crosschecking,
which is mandatory for the work I do and when this happens with the Notebook,
it crumbles under the workload and I had to spend good number of hours sitting
as a duck in front of the notebook waiting to happen what I had intended it to
do.
All of a sudden, a screen flashes a message across my monitor, ‘your
windows require an update’ and things come to a stalk halt. All it wants me to
send a few clicks to allow it to happen to my software. The company must have
thought that I should be thankful to it as it was working day and night to
solve the issues which I have not faced so far and here it was ready with a
solution. Do I really need it? Did I ask for it? Why my operating system is not
so smart as to know my needs and work on only those aspects of features I have
been using frequently? If it is not, then I must say that my software is really
outdated and needs to be sent back to the company for the repair.
I want a complete software which is smart enough to my requirements
and work as quickly as I have been. It must come to my age to understand my
needs and of course choices. I am of strong opinion that all features that I do
not use should be put in an archive and the computer should install only on demand
and it should not use my data, my time, my hardware unnecessarily and leave the
space which I buy for every penny.
Please, give a complete software and make it smart enough to understand
my requirements and then work accordingly. Otherwise, be prepared to refund the
price you charge for the incomplete software.
